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Marylebone to Disley start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Marylebone to Disley start from £75.90 one way, or £108.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Marylebone to Disley are available for £184.70 one way, or £369.40 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

London Marylebone Station is equipped with a range of facilities designed to ensure a convenient and accessible experience for all travelers. There is a well-staffed ticket office, open from early morning to late at night, along with ticket machines accessible to those with disabilities. You can rest easy knowing that step-free access is available throughout the station, making it accessible for everyone. Additionally, induction loops are in place for those with hearing impairments.

Although there aren’t wa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as. You will also find public toilets, accessible toilets, and baby changing facilities within the station, which are essential for any long-distance journey. If you're looking for a place to grab a bite or a coffee, there are various food outlets and coffee shops. The station even hosts a small selection of shops, including a newsagent, a flower stall, and a shoe repairer among others. Wi-Fi connectivity is readily available, ensuring you remain connected while on the move.

Onward Travel from London Marylebone

At London Marylebone Station, you have access to a multitude of onward travel options. The taxi rank right outside the station provides easy connections, with buses also readily available nearby. Those heading into the heart of London can make use of the Marylebone Underground station, which is on the Bakerloo Line. A short walk will take you to Baker Street station, where you can board Circle, Hammersmith and City, Jubilee, and Metropolitan Line services.

For those keen on cycling, you'll be pleased to find a Santander Cycles docking station located conveniently at Boston Place, right at the side of Marylebone Station. A good amount of secure bicycle storage is also offered for season ticket holders, perfect for those integrating cycling into their daily commute.

Facilities and Services at Disley Station

When you arrive at Disley Station,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 07:10 and 10:10, and while it's not open on weekends, accessible ticket machines are available, ensuring everyone can easily purchase or collect tickets. While the station itself doesn’t have a waiting room, there is a seating area available for those moments before your departure.

Accessibility is a key feature at this station. Although there is no step-free access across the entire station, part of it is scooter-friendly, ensuring easier mobility for those who need it. The station also provides ramps for train access, making it a practical choice for travelers with limited mobility. Moreover, the induction loop is an excellent facility for those using hearing aids.

It's important to note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site, so grabbing a coffee or a bite to eat might need to be scheduled outside the station. However, the pleasant village surroundings more than make up for this, with local establishments ready to serve weary travelers.

Getting Around: Transport Options from Disley

Disley Station provides several options for onward travel. For those moments when rail replacement services are necessary, buses heading to Buxton and Manchester conveniently stop near the Rams Head Pub on the A6. Taxis can be arranged through services like Cab4You, providing quick and easy transport to surrounding areas.

Alternatively, local buses are accessible by dialing Busline on 0871 200 2233, offering regular services to various destinations. Although bicycle hire is not available directly from the station, c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the beautiful paths and routes that Cheshire offers.
